AWS亞馬遜云負載均衡規格介紹
AWS亞馬遜云是全球領先的云計算服務提供商,其強大的負載均衡能力為企業提供了高效、可靠的解決方案。負載均衡作為AWS基礎設施中的重要組成部分,可以有效地將網絡流量分配到多個服務器上,確保應用程序的高可用性和性能。本文將詳細介紹AWS亞馬遜云的負載均衡規格,并結合其優勢和使用的便捷性進行探討。
經典負載均衡器(Classic Load Balancer)
經典負載均衡器是AWS早期推出的一種負載均衡服務,適用于傳統的EC2實例架構。它支持HTTP、HTTPS和TCP協議,可以在多個可用區之間分發流量。經典負載均衡器具備自動擴展和健康檢查功能,能夠確保服務器實例的高可用性。雖然現在被應用負載均衡器和網絡負載均衡器所取代,但它依然是一些傳統應用的理想選擇。
應用負載均衡器(application Load Balancer)
應用負載均衡器是AWS專門為現代化應用架構設計的,它支持HTTP/HTTPS協議和WebSocket連接,并能夠針對應用層流量進行高級路由。與經典負載均衡器相比,應用負載均衡器能夠更細粒度地控制流量,比如基于URL路徑、HTTP頭或查詢參數等內容進行路由。此規格特別適合需要處理復雜請求和微服務架構的應用程序。
網絡負載均衡器(Network Load Balancer)
網絡負載均衡器是針對低延遲、高吞吐量的網絡流量設計的,支持TCP、UDP和TLS協議。它能夠在保持高性能的同時,處理數百萬的請求,每秒支持數千個連接的并發。網絡負載均衡器在處理極端流量場景時表現尤為突出,例如物聯網應用、金融服務和實時在線游戲等。
目標組和健康檢查功能
AWS的負載均衡器使用目標組來定義流量的接收端,并通過健康檢查功能來確保流量只會分配給健康的目標。健康檢查可以基于多種標準,包括協議、路徑和響應時間等,確保應用程序的可靠性。無論是應用負載均衡器還是網絡負載均衡器,健康檢查功能都能自動識別并隔離故障實例,從而最大程度地提升系統的穩定性。
AWS負載均衡的自動擴展能力
AWS負載均衡器與自動擴展組無縫集成,可以根據流量的變化自動調整實例的數量。當流量增加時,負載均衡器會自動分配更多的實例來處理請求;當流量減少時,它則會縮減實例數量以節省成本。這種自動化管理不僅提高了應用的響應能力,還降低了運營成本,使企業能夠專注于核心業務發展。
安全性與合規性
AWS負載均衡器在安全性方面提供了多層次的保護,包括通過TLS加密傳輸數據、防止DDoS攻擊和集成AWS Web應用防火墻(waf)等。負載均衡器還支持跨多個可用區的冗余配置,確保在單個區域出現故障時應用程序仍能保持正常運行。此外,AWS的負載均衡服務符合多項國際安全標準和法規要求,如ISO、SOC、PCI-DSS等,能夠滿足不同行業的合規需求。
易于管理與部署
AWS負載均衡器通過AWS管理控制臺、CLI和API提供簡便的管理和配置界面,使用戶可以輕松進行部署和監控。此外,AWS還提供詳細的文檔和技術支持,幫助用戶快速上手并解決潛在問題。結合AWS的其他服務,如CloudWatch和CloudTrail,用戶可以對負載均衡器的性能進行全面監控和審計,進一步提升運維效率。
總結
AWS亞馬遜云的負載均衡器憑借其高性能、高可用性和易用性,為企業提供了可靠的流量管理解決方案。無論是經典負載均衡器、應用負載均衡器還是網絡負載均衡器,AWS都能滿足不同應用場景下的需求。此外,自動擴展、健康檢查和強大的安全性使AWS負載均衡器成為現代企業數字化轉型的理想選擇。在未來的發展中,隨著云計算技術的不斷演進,AWS負載均衡器將繼續為用戶提供更加出色的服務體驗。